KMI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2019 in Review

1,106 of the 4,561 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Kinder Morgan (KMI) for Q3 2019, worth a combined $29.4B — down 0.72% from $29.6B a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 91 funds closed out of KMI and 83 opened new positions — a net loss of 8 holders — while 381 trimmed existing stakes and 482 added.

The largest buyer was Bank of America, adding an estimated $422M. The largest seller was Brookfield Corp, exiting entirely with an estimated $277M sold.
